A poem to Xerochrysum Viscosum, an everlasting daisy native to Naarm (Melbourne), Victoria. A proposal for multiple players and machines. Endless piano and tape loop variations. A music for three pianos in the advent of isolation. Emblematic of the cyclic dream and trance states of Maya Deren’s, ‘Meshes of the Afternoon’; and the soft pedal work of Harold Budd.
